Religion
All ideologies are idiotic, whether religious or political, for it is conceptual thinking, which has so unfortunately divided man.
- J. Krishnamurti
The whole purpose of religion is to facilitate love and compassion, patience, tolerance, humility, and forgiveness.
- Dalai Lama Xiv
Any system of religion that has anything in it that shocks the mind of a child, cannot be a true system.
- Thomas Paine
A religious person knows how to embrace things in a right manner; an irreligious
person simply renounces things out of "fear".
- Deep Trivedi
How can living life to the fullest with much passion, fun and happiness or moving
towards success, ever be irreligious? Irreligiousness itself begins with renouncing
the things out of fear.
- Deep Trivedi
Religion is regarded by the common people as true, by the wise as false, and by the rulers as useful.
- Seneca the Younger
We must remember that the test of our religious principles lies not just in what we say, not only in our prayers, not even in living blameless lives - but in what we do for others
- Harry S. Truman
When one person suffers from a delusion it is called insanity; when many people suffer from a delusion it is called religion.
- Robert M. Pirsig
Do you become spiritual by performing ceremonies and rituals…? Ceremonies and rituals sometimes give a certain sensation, so-called uplift. But they are repetitious, and every sensation that is repeated soon wearies of itself.
- J. Krishnamurti
Superstition is to religion what astrology is to astronomy the mad daughter of a wise mother. These daughters have too long dominated the earth.
- Voltaire
